How to get delete option on iphone mail

To get the delete option on iPhone Mail, follow these steps:

Method 1: Swipe Left

  1. Open the Mail app on your iPhone.
  2. Swipe your finger left across the message you want to delete.
  3. A "Delete" button will appear. Tap on it to delete the message.

Method 2: Tap and Hold

  1. Open the Mail app on your iPhone.
  2. Tap and hold on the message you want to delete until a menu appears.
  3. Tap on "More" and then select "Delete" from the menu.

Method 3: Use the Edit Button

  1. Open the Mail app on your iPhone.
  2. Tap on the "Edit" button in the top-right corner of the screen.
  3. A checkmark will appear next to each message. Tap on the checkmark next to the message you want to delete.
  4. Tap on the "Delete" button at the bottom of the screen.
